Static mechanical load tests apply also to suction loads: 2,400Pa are the equivalent of winds blowing at a speed of 130km/h, with safety factor 3 for gusts of wind. While testing our X63 panel we exceeded test requirements of IEC 61215 and evenly exerted a load of approximately 1,400kg (i.e.800kg/m²) on its entire surface (so much to give an idea, the equivalent of two meters of wet snow with a specific weight of 400kg/m²). During this laboratory test, load and pressure are fixed, while the direction of the force changes every hour. Static mechanical load standard tests perform a pressure load on the photovoltaic panel in a constant manner.
